Break-Glass: tailr CLI (Ridgeline Platform)

On-call use only. If the log-tailing CLI loses its session during an incident and the auth service is down, break-glass is permitted. Record the incident number afterward. The CLI will prompt for emergency credentials on restart. Authenticate with the recovery passphrase below.

vault phrase of bagaf-kajeg = jorath-feniel-briir-siliel-ralix

## Changelog — Retryburrow v2.7

Heads up for the sync: we rotated the signing key that the export retry worker uses to re-authenticate failed export jobs. Old key was getting close to expiry and a couple of retries bounced last Tuesday because of it. Everything in the Pinefield queue has been replayed cleanly since. If you run the worker locally, grab the new key or your retries will 403. New key is right here below.

deploy key for tahof-yadup: bky6_JWeaJq

## Configuration — PedalShift

PedalShift figures out which bike-share docks in Lowbranch are overflowing and schedules rebalancing van runs. Config lives in a plain .env file. Set REBALANCE_INTERVAL_MIN (default 15) and DOCK_PRESSURE_THRESHOLD (default 0.8) to taste. The dispatcher talks to the van-routing API with a credential, which goes on the line right after this sentence.

env line for fafof-fahag: LEDGER_TOKEN5=f8790